The Diocese of Gaylord’s 2026 Catholic Services Appeal is centered on the theme One Bread, One Body, inspired by Pope Leo’s motto, “In the One, we are One.” As the first American pope, his words call us to recognize the unity we share through Christ in the Eucharist. Nourished by the one Bread, we are strengthened to serve together as one body, supporting the mission and ministries of our diocese through your generous support of the Catholic Services Appeal.
